“In line with the agreements of the Euro-Mediterranean Conferences and Mid Term Meetings of Foreign Ministers in Valencia, 22-23 April 2002, in Crete 26-27 May 2003, in Naples, 2-3 December 2003 (Doc 57/03) and in Dublin, 5-6 May 2004, the EuroMed Foundation (hereinafter referred to as “the FOUNDATION”) will be called the “Anna Lindh Euro-Mediterranean Foundation for the Dialogue between Cultures". The Foundation shall have its headquarters in the Alexandria Library in tandem with the Swedish Institute in Alexandria.”

Objectives and Tasks

1. The Foundation will promote the dialogue between cultures and contribute to the visibility of the Barcelona Process through intellectual, cultural and civil society exchanges. In particular, the Foundation will

promote knowledge, recognition and mutual respect between the cultures, traditions and values which prevail in the partners.

to identify, develop and promote areas of cultural convergence between the Euro-Mediterranean countries and peoples, with the aim in particular of promoting tolerance , cultural understanding and avoiding stereotypes, xenophobia and racism,

encourage initiatives which aim at promoting a dialogue between religions in the Euro-Mediterranean region.

promote the human dimension of the partnership as well as the consolidation of the rule of law and of basic freedoms in accordance with the guidelines of the regional cooperation programme which was also adopted in this field by the Valencia Conference (April 2002).

underline the vital importance of ensuring that all partners encourage the development and deepening of the cultural and human dimension of the Euro-Mediterranean partnership in all its aspects and its various components at bilateral or multilateral level.

2. The Foundation shall perform the following tasks within its areas of activity:

establish and coordinate, in consultation and in cooperation with the competent authorities and organisations of the members of the Euro Mediterranean partnership, the network of national networks referred to in Article XII in order to act as a catalyst to develop the activities of the networks and provide an inventory of co-operation between them.

promote intellectual, cultural and civil society exchanges,

promote a continuous debate using in particular multi-media techniques (television, radio, periodical magazine, Internet) in co-operation with existing media and with the participation of people from both shores including journalists and the young ,

give patronage to important events which promote mutual understanding, co-financed by large media groups and/or festivals and institutions already active in these areas,

promote the activities of the Barcelona Process including by means of the Foundation itself (periodical magazine, Internet site)
